    So I'm gonna run through multiple issues at hand and anything you can provide I GREATLY appreciate. For starters its a 2002 GP GT w/ 107xxx on the clock

    1. My emergency brake light is coming on at random....is there some sort of sensor for it somewhere?

    2. How difficult is it to get to the plugs on the 3.8; mines never had them changed and she's starting to misfire and throw an SES at random.

    3. This ones gonna be my biggest one. So let me preface, about 2k-3k ago I changed my wheel hub assemblies (both front and left front were done...only ones needed), they wouldn't pass my inspection without new ones. Long story shoort I did buy the NTP brand name ones from advance. (This may bea tangent and unrelated sorry lol) but in the past few weeks I've noticed when accelerating and the car is in the higher rpm band (3.5k - 5k) through the steering wheel and pedals it feels like I'm driving over the drunk bumps on the side of the interstate. It worse when accelerating uphill. Also REALLY rears its ugly head in corners ESP when accelerating through or out of a corner. It almost feels like the car is gonna fall apart. What in the world could this be? Could it be those crappy NTP hubs I was warned against buying or something worse?

    1. could be the pedal sensor under the dash, or the low brake fluid sensor in the master cylinder.
    2.They are not bad at all, remove the two dog bones up top and pull the engine forward with a ratchet strap.
    3. Could be bad struts starting to stick, or a cv axle, jack the car up and back sure the bearings and ball joints are tight by moving the wheel side to side and up and down.

    Add some brake fluid, Its low. I bet the pads are getting low, As the pads ware the caliper piston travels further and more fluids needed. If it wasnt full to begin with then it will go low and kick the light
